Subject: Btrfs: remove BUG_ON in __add_tree_block
Git-commit: cdccee993f2f3466f69a358daec19de744a02f92
Patch-mainline: v4.14-rc1
References: bsc#1149325

The BUG_ON() can be triggered when the caller is processing an invalid
extent inline ref, e.g.

a shared data ref is offered instead of an extent data ref, such that
it tries to find a non-existent tree block and then btrfs_search_slot
returns 1 for no such item.

This replaces the BUG_ON() with a WARN() followed by calling
btrfs_print_leaf() to show more details about what's going on and
returning -EINVAL to upper callers.
